The roles that a Blockchain CoE can possibly have are as follows:
Blockchain architects
Blockchain and smart contract developers
DevOps and cloud expert
Business analyst
Web developer
Quality engineer

20.2.4 Factors to Consider for Production
Many Blockchain projects fail as the managers and architects do not
consider all the aspects of the underlying protocol, especially until
they enter production. The previous chapters have given the reader
a good amount of guidance on different Blockchain types along with
the comparison of their features. On the top of that, the following
factors have to be considered before finalising a Blockchain protocol:
Supported cloud platforms
Cost of licenses in production
